Armed Citizen® Today

Officers in Merced County, Calif., responded to a burglary call, only to find the two alleged burglars being held at gunpoint by a homeowner.

The call came on the evening of Saturday, April 1. When police arrived, they found the homeowner, a Merced County CCW permit holder, along with the two burglars and a vehicle allegedly belonging to the suspects. According to local reports, the vehicle was stuck in a ditch and contained several items belonging to the homeowner.

Officers took the two burglary suspects into custody and booked them on suspicion of burglary, as well as several other outstanding warrants. (Your Central Valley; Merced, Calif.; 4/1/24)

From the Armed Citizen® Archives – July 1983

The occupants of a Waterbury, Conn., cafe were accosted by a pair of armed men and forced to lie on the floor. With his accomplice posted by the door, a pistol-wielding hoodlum removed money from behind the counter and took cash from the customers and owner. One patron began arguing, and as a scuffle ensued, the owner retrieved a revolver. Firing three shots, he drove the would-be robbers from his establishment. (The Republican, Waterbury, Conn.)
